What Is Crawl Space Encapsulation?

While crawl space encapsulation may sound like a strange concept, in reality, it is fairly straightforward. Our team begins the process by identifying and fixing any existing problems that are contributing directly to the buildup of moisture in your crawl space. After those issues are addressed, our team will remove as much moisture from the crawl space as possible, and then seal it with a barrier made of polyethylene. This plastic can be used on the floor, walls, and even the ceiling of your crawl space to create a watertight barrier that stops moisture from getting inside your crawl space.

Signs You Need Expert Crawl Space Encapsulation Services

Perhaps one of the best things to be mindful of is a stale or mildew type of smell coming from your crawl space or in the area around it. Should you notice this smell, it’s a sure-fire sign you need an urgent crawl space inspection and subsequent waterproofing services. Similarly, should you notice any drastic uneven flooring in your home, contact A-1 Concrete and Leveling right away. It’s also common for you to notice or experience floor rot in your crawl space due to the level of moisture that can gather over time; if your flooring is buckling or bouncy in any way, crawl space insulation can help.

High humidity levels in your crawl space also have the potential to affect your home’s energy bills. This is because your home’s air conditioner or HVAC system has to work harder to keep up with the humidity. Should you out of nowhere see your energy bills increase dramatically, it can be a sign your crawl space is the source and need to be waterproofed as soon as possible. In a similar vein, visible condensation or extreme humidity are also big indicators that crawl space encapsulation and crawl space insulation needs to be performed.
